Armie Hammer And Timothée Chalamet To Reunite In 'Call Me By Your Name' Sequel
Director Luca Guadagnino reveals he's working on a new script.
After winning Best Adapted Screenplay at the 90th Academy Awards, romantic drama 'Call Me By Your Name' is set to be getting a sequel as director Luca Guadagnino reveals that he's already working on a new story for Oliver and Elio. The new movie will be set elsewhere in the world.

Based on the 2007 novel of the same name by André Aciman, this tale of romance between an American-Italian teen boy and a 24-year-old Jewish scholar on an Italian vacation has received immense critical acclaim - so much so that a follow-up is already being discussed between Guadagnino and Aciman.
